Ripple Effects

Rate this book
Recent college graduate and Broadway star wannabe Penny O'Brien returns to the Boundary Waters for a funeral one year after her canoe-camping adventure with Northern Woods. She stumbles into a job in Misty Lake to supplement her meager gig income and finance auditions.




Beckett Young lives and works in Cincinnati, far away from his elitist family, but he maintains the perks of his trust fund. The tragic death of his beloved aunt plunges him into depression until he's summoned to Misty Lake for the reading of her will. A stunning redhead in the tiny town captures his attention, and while casual dating is Beckett's usual MO to avoid hassles with his family, he's enchanted with the practical and fiercely independent woman.




Penny is all in for a short-term fling with a classy guy. But after a few dates with Beckett Young, it's clear they're barreling toward something more serious. How will they juggle a long-distance relationship in the midst of his meddling parents and her struggling career?

About the author

Amy Hepp

6 books17 followers
Amy writes contemporary romance amongst the birds and blue skies of Raleigh, NC. Her stories are set in the fiercely protected Boundary Waters Canoe Wilderness Area of northern Minnesota, providing an idyllic backdrop for her characters to fall in and out of love. When not puzzling together a plot, she can be found walking around her neighborhood, eating chocolate, or visiting her three adult children scattered across North America.

This is another wonderful romance novel by Ms. Hepp. It revolves around Penny O’Brien, who returns to the Boundary Waters a year after her canoeing trip in the Northern Woods. While working in Misty Lake, she meets Beckett Young, a Cincinnati resident summoned to attend the reading of his aunt's will after her untimely death.

Penny and Beckett date casually, but as time passes, both realize their relationship is taking a more serious turn. They face challenges like maintaining their long-distance relationship and dealing with Beckett's parents, who interfere in their amorous affairs.

The novel has many scenes depicting several situations in Penny and Beckett’s relationship, which they have to overcome. That made it a page-turner for me.

Ms. Hepp’s unique writing style is evidenced in her narrative and her well-developed and relatable characters. The descriptive imagery of the settings in the novel is so well defined that it transports the reader into the novel’s world. The novel is truly enjoyable, especially for those of us who like romance.
